Roasted garlic and white bean soup

The roasted garlic gives this hearty soup a warm and delicious flavour without the strong pungent flavours associated with this root vegetable.

Ingredients:
2 cans white beans, rinsed and drained
2 potatoes cut in large pieces
2 sprigs rosemary removed from stalk and finely chopped
1 onion
1 bulb garlic
1 1/2 tablespoon olive oil
1 bay leaf
1/2 teaspoon oregano
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 litre stock
Salt and pepper to taste

Method:

  1. Slice off the top of bulb of garlic to reveal most of garlic cloves without peel.
  2. Drizzle olive oil on garlic and cook in 150C oven for about 20-30 minutes or when garlic browns.
  3. Sautee onion with 2 tablespoons of stock until softened.
  4. Add all ingredients except for salt and pepper and bring to boil then simmer for 30 minutes or longer.
  5. Season the soup.
  6. If you like a slightly chunky soup, remove several ladles of beans and give it a quick mash.
  7. Process soup until it is smooth and creamy.
  8. For chunky soup option, return the mashed beans into the rest of the soup.
